Brown Derby's Original Cobb Salad



1/2 head of lettuce

1/2 bunch watercress

1 small bunch chicory

1/2 head romaine

2 medium tomatoes, peeled

2 breasts of boiled roasting chicken slices

6 strips crisp bacon

1 avocado

3 hard-cooked eggs

2 tablespoons chopped chives

1/2 cup crumbled imported Roquefort cheese

1 cup Brown Derby Old-Fashioned French Dressing (See recipe, below)



Cut finely lettuce, watercress, chicory and romaine and arrange in salad

bowl. Cut tomatoes in half, remove seeds, dice finely, and arrange over

top of chopped greens. Dice breasts of chicken and arrange over top of

chopped greens. Chop bacon finely and sprinkle over the salad. Cut avocado

in small pieces and arrange around the edge of the salad. Decorate the

salad by sprinkling over the top the chopped eggs, chopped chives, and

grated cheese. Just before serving mix the salad thoroughly

with French Dressing.

Yield: Serves 4 to 6



Brown Derby Old-Fashioned French Dressing

1 cup water

1 cup red wine vinegar

1 teaspoon sugar

Juice of 1/2 lemon

2 1/2 teaspoons salt

1 teaspoon ground black pepper

1 teaspoon Worcestershire sauce

1 teaspoon English mustard

1 clove garlic, chopped

1 cup olive oil

3 cups salad (vegetable) oil



Blend together all ingredients except oils. Then add olive and salad oils

and mix well again. Chill. Shake before serving. Makes about 1 1/2 quarts.

This dressing keeps well in the refrigerator.

Can be made and stored in a 2-quart Mason jar.
